Data Snapshot: ZIP 04660 (Mount Desert, ME)

ZIP 04660 (Mount Desert, ME) shows an average homeowners insurance premium of $2,491 per year as of 2022, based on U.S. Treasury FIO ZIP-level observations across approximately 17 reported policies. That is 40% above the national average of $1,776 per year, placing this ZIP in the 89th percentile nationally. Compared to the Maine state average of $1,294, this ZIP runs 93% above, reflecting neighborhood-level differences in catastrophe exposure, property age, and claims history.

The loss ratio for ZIP 04660 is 1.2%, meaning insurers retained a working margin after claims. Claim frequency — the share of policies with at least one claim — is 0.97%, and the average claim severity (amount paid per claim) is $3,102. Nonrenewal — insurers declining to extend coverage at policy expiration — occurs at 0.81% in this ZIP, a drop of 17.8% over the past five years; rising nonrenewal often signals insurer retreat from high-risk markets.

Across 5 years (2018–2022), premiums in ZIP 04660 have risen by 5.5%, ranging from $2,362 to $2,491 with a five-year average of $2,445 — an annualized rate of +1.3% per year. FIO data aggregates voluntary reporting from the 40 largest homeowners insurers, covering roughly 80% of the U.S. market, so figures represent market averages rather than individual policy quotes; your own premium will vary with dwelling value, deductible, coverage limits, construction type, and insurer-specific underwriting. Premium History

Year Avg Premium YoY Change
2018 $2,362
2019 $2,406 +1.9%
2020 $2,482 +3.1%
2021 $2,486 +0.2%
2022 $2,491 +0.2%
